Output 62c3628ac33df307f2e658d9150c26a722c2479e751078365b9fe08d03ec1d79:1

value
275820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a789e2871b3b074962032c50942b0007131a1849 OP_EQUAL
address
3GxswzHN3d6mHUYZ8Qd5FnXfR18t8RxyJe
transaction
62c3628ac33df307f2e658d9150c26a722c2479e751078365b9fe08d03ec1d79
spent
true